I Love Spreading Misinformation On The Internet Meme

The phrase I love spreading misinformation on the internet has become a recognizable meme across social media platforms, often shared ironically, sarcastically, or as a form of dark humor. At first glance, the meme can seem alarming, especially in a digital age where misinformation is a serious concern. However, the popularity of this meme is not about genuinely promoting false information, but rather about commenting on internet culture, irony, and the chaotic way information spreads online.

The Origins of the Meme Culture

How Internet Humor Evolved

Internet memes have long relied on exaggeration, irony, and shock value. The I love spreading misinformation on the internet meme fits neatly into this tradition. It emerged from online spaces where users parody bad-faith arguments, conspiracy theories, and confidently incorrect posts that circulate widely.

Rather than being a literal statement, the meme exaggerates a behavior that many people find frustrating online individuals sharing false claims with absolute confidence.

Why the Meme Can Be Misinterpreted

The Risk of Context Collapse

One challenge with ironic memes is that not everyone reads them the same way. When shared without context, the meme can appear to promote misinformation rather than criticize it.

This phenomenon, sometimes called context collapse, is common on large platforms where audiences have different backgrounds, values, and levels of media literacy.
